Background / History

White Fang is a top-tier shinobi active during the Second Shinobi World War. His chakra-infused short blade earned him the name “Konoha’s White Fang,” and he became the youngest and strongest Anbu captain in Konoha’s history. 2 32

He oversees the interrogation of the captured Amegakure child Li Tong. Initially treating him as a hostile enemy, White Fang authorizes Yamanaka Oniichi’s dangerous Mind Reading technique to verify Li Tong’s claimed amnesia. 2

After the examination, White Fang personally offers Li Tong recruitment into Konoha. He explains that Li Tong’s survival is essential to the Third Hokage’s policy of accepting enemy defectors, while bluntly warning that the previous eight comparable defectors all died or disappeared. 4

White Fang continues to supervise Li Tong’s case after his release. He investigates attacks against him, repeatedly questions the implausible circumstances of Li Tong’s kills, and warns him that the Hyuga Clan may turn to Black Market assassins. 11 21 25 32

Following Li Tong’s counter-kill of Uesugi Kama, White Fang identifies the victim as the Elite Jonin assassin “Sickle Without Hook.” His familiarity with Uesugi comes from an inconclusive engagement four years earlier, when both were Elite Jonin. 31 32

Personality

White Fang is calm, detached, and disciplined even during interrogation or crisis. He speaks economically, rarely reveals more than necessary, and maintains an unreadable demeanor around both prisoners and subordinates. 2 5

Despite this distance, he is direct with Li Tong when the situation demands it. He openly explains the danger faced by defectors, gives practical survival advice, and grants Li Tong latitude to eliminate foreign spies in Konoha. 4 5 25

He is politically perceptive but not fully aware of Hiruzen Sarutobi’s deeper intentions. White Fang recognizes that Li Tong is being used within Konoha’s clan tensions and attempts to improve the boy’s odds of surviving the resulting threats. 25 36

Story Role / Major Arcs

Li Tong’s Capture and Defection

White Fang leads the Anbu response to Li Tong’s capture, conducts his interrogation, and approves the memory examination that establishes Li Tong’s amnesia. He subsequently recruits Li Tong into Konoha as part of a larger wartime defector-acceptance strategy. 2 4

Protection of a Contested Defector

After Li Tong’s release, White Fang explains that threats against him come from both Amegakure and Konoha’s internal factions. He investigates Hyuga Anan’s death and warns Li Tong that official restraint from the Hyuga Clan does not eliminate covert danger. 5 21 25

Spy-Hunting Authorization

White Fang responds favorably when Li Tong kills Amegakure spy Qifeng and declares his loyalty to Konoha. He then permits Li Tong to eliminate foreign spies, intending both to aid Konoha and to help Li Tong develop the means to survive future assassination attempts. 24 25

Uesugi Kama Investigation

White Fang is shocked by Li Tong’s apparent killing of Uesugi Kama, an Elite Jonin Black Market assassin. Unable to accept Li Tong’s explanation that the assassin simply “choked on water,” he reports his concerns to Hiruzen and theorizes that a powerful hidden protector may be assisting Li Tong. 31 32 33 35
